Check for Mold and Mildew

Stay alert for any indications of mold and mildew in and around your ductless AC unit, such as persistent musty odors or visible patches. Addressing this issue promptly is crucial. Cleaning the impacted spots with a water and vinegar solution or choosing a cleaner specifically designed to combat mold can be effective strategies. Additionally, employing a dehumidifier to lower humidity levels within the area can serve as a preventative measure against the growth of mold and mildew, ensuring a healthier indoor atmosphere.

Clearing Blockages

The presence of stagnant water in the drainage system, often caused by blockages, can foster bacterial growth, leading to unpleasant odors. It’s important to inspect the drainage tubing or condensate line frequently for any signs of clogs and clear them immediately. Regularly flushing the drainage system with a blend of water and bleach not only eliminates bacteria but also prevents the recurrence of blockages, maintaining a clean and odor-free system.

Odor Absorbing Solutions

Opting for natural solutions like activated charcoal or baking soda can be a highly effective way to combat unpleasant smells. These substances, when placed near the AC unit, work wonders in absorbing odors, offering an eco-friendly alternative to chemical air fresheners. For those seeking more advanced solutions, commercial odor absorbers or air purifiers featuring activated carbon filters can significantly improve indoor air quality, providing a fresher and more inviting living space.
